Transaction f073fc11a2aed64deb4b5f195b7f8d370ecc6ef8fe8d858175c105d10df52308
1 Input
2 Outputs
- f073fc11a2aed64deb4b5f195b7f8d370ecc6ef8fe8d858175c105d10df52308:0
- f073fc11a2aed64deb4b5f195b7f8d370ecc6ef8fe8d858175c105d10df52308:1
value 12472788470
address 17DJXtUne4djQzpnwnhepUft5sEyHJPrKa
value 22450000
address 1Du65Jfu2GG6bPRcxPr1bSziYpmm1HbEhJ